So, roughly speaking, a '4K' game might render a 2K image when things are quiet, and upscale to 4K, but drop to a lower rendered resolution (still upscaled to 4K) when a lot is happening onscreen (explosions, loads of enemies, etc.) This doesn't always affect the output resolution, as things can be scaled up. Dynamic scaling/resolution means that a game varies the resolution it renders at, usually depending on the processing power needed at any given moment. ![]() It's practically indistinguishable to the human eye, but technically not 'true' 4K. A filter then reconstructs the missing parts to create the target resolution, using less processing power as a result. Checkerboard rendering is a way of essentially splitting a screen image into a tiny grid and only rendering every other square.It's worth noting that when framerates are noticed and discussed, it's usually because they're changing or unstable, not necessarily because they're lower.
